The factory kit isn't much to speak of, but the one tool you will absolutely need is the nut adapter to get the rear axle off. It looks like two nuts attached to each other, one end goes in the axle, and you put a wrench or socket in the other end. If you can't find one since they are a Buell specific part, you can weld two nuts together. There are lots of t27torx bits, get one long enough to reach into the tight spots and another short one. |

I know you can turn around some spark plug sockets that have a hex on the back side and use that as an axle tool (saves space and $$'s) ... too late in your case I guess. Don't forget about the big allen head pinch bolt for the axles. I agree, it would be nice to make a complete list of tools for road repairs. 7/8" coupling nut is the cheapest axle tool I found. See 90264A221 in McMaster. It's $1.85. |
